Tavares named Overall Player of the Week

February 18, 2004 - National Lacrosse League (NLL) News Release


John Tavares of the Buffalo Bandits has been named the Overall Player of the Week for the second time this season. Tavares lead the Bandits to victories over both Toronto and Anaheim in Week #8 action. Tavares scored two goals and four assists for six points in a 13-9 win over Toronto on February 13th and three goals, three assists for six points in a 13-11 win over Anaheim on February 14th.

Jeff Ratcliffe of the Philadelphia Wings was named the Offensive Player of the Week for his eight-point performance in the Wings 16-12 victory over the Arizona Sting on February 14th. Ratcliffe scored four goals and added four assists.

Pat O'Toole of the Rochester Knighthawks was named the Defensive Player of the Week for his performance in the Knighthawks 10-9 win over San Jose on February 14th. O'Toole held the Stealth to nine goals and recorded 45 saves.

Ryan Ward of the Philadelphia Wings was named the Rookie of the Week for his performance in the Wings 16-12 win over Arizona on February 14th. Ward scored one goal, and tallied two assists for three points while collecting six loose balls in the game.
